| /** | ||
| * Default key-count cutoff below which an unknown-key sweep inlines `!==` | ||
| * comparisons instead of a hoisted `Set`. Chosen so typical schema objects stay | ||
| * on the faster inline path while pathologically wide objects fall back to the | ||
| * `Set`'s O(1) lookup. | ||
| */ | ||
| export const INLINE_KEY_LIMIT = 16; | ||
| /** | ||
| * Builds the "is this an undeclared key" test used by `additionalProperties: | ||
| * false` sweeps in the generated parsers and validators. | ||
| * | ||
| * For a small number of known keys V8 evaluates a chain of `!==` string | ||
| * comparisons faster than `Set.has` (which has to hash the string), and the | ||
| * inline form skips the per-module `Set` allocation — the same shape Ajv and | ||
| * TypeBox compile to. Above `inlineLimit` the chain grows long enough that the | ||
| * `Set`'s O(1) lookup wins, so a `Set` named `setName` is hoisted instead. | ||
| * | ||
| * @example | ||
| * const check = unknownKeyCheck(['id', 'name'], '_knownKeys0') | ||
| * check.declarations // [] | ||
| * check.isUnknown('_k') // '_k !== "id" && _k !== "name"' | ||
| * check.isKnown('_k') // '_k === "id" || _k === "name"' | ||
| */ | ||
| export const unknownKeyCheck = (knownKeys, setName, inlineLimit = INLINE_KEY_LIMIT) => { | ||
| if (knownKeys.length === 0) { | ||
| return { declarations: [], isUnknown: () => 'true', isKnown: () => 'false' }; | ||
| } | ||
| if (knownKeys.length <= inlineLimit) { | ||
| return { | ||
| declarations: [], | ||
| isUnknown: (keyVar) => knownKeys.map((key) => `${keyVar} !== ${JSON.stringify(key)}`).join(' && '), | ||
| isKnown: (keyVar) => knownKeys.map((key) => `${keyVar} === ${JSON.stringify(key)}`).join(' || '), | ||
| }; | ||
| } | ||
| return { | ||
| declarations: [`const ${setName} = new Set(${JSON.stringify(knownKeys)})`], | ||
| isUnknown: (keyVar) => `!${setName}.has(${keyVar})`, | ||
| isKnown: (keyVar) => `${setName}.has(${keyVar})`, | ||
| }; | ||
| }; |
